Stephen Marshall 1854–1920 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1 Dec 1854

Birth Location: Rolvenden, Kent, England

Death Date: 31 Jan 1920

Death Location: Small Hythe, Kent, England

Father: Stephen* Jr

Mother: Ellen Bryant

Spouse(s): Amy Marshall

Children(s): William Marshall

Stephen Marshall was born in 1854 in Rolvenden, Kent, England, the child of Stephen Marshall Jr And Ellen Matilda Bryant. Stephen Marshall married Amy Ernest James Marshall, and had children including William Marshall. Stephen Marshall passed away in 1920 in Small Hythe, Kent, England.
